Transaction d16fa0d1573eac3f72e79f7ebe69e96b825d1a645173336aec815ad16ed2bc44
2 Input
2 Outputs
- d16fa0d1573eac3f72e79f7ebe69e96b825d1a645173336aec815ad16ed2bc44:0
- d16fa0d1573eac3f72e79f7ebe69e96b825d1a645173336aec815ad16ed2bc44:1
value 24186261
address 32wPomHhFuRQSeNbAfHxVeBwPuoTWeNcGx
value 13756931
address 13eYFHTNLUuuPMJ39rn7cXobSc1PEkndvt